Description

The Excess Payment Letter Format in Suffolk is a formal template used to notify an individual or entity of an overpayment made to the state. This letter includes key sections: a clear subject line, the sender's contact information, and a detailed explanation of the overpayment, along with relevant payment details. Users should ensure that the date, recipient information, and specific payment details are accurately filled in. The letter is particularly useful for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ants, as it provides a professional way to communicate financial corrections. The use of an enclosed Payment Voucher and check number enhances clarity, allowing the recipient to reference the overpayment easily. By using this format, recipients can promptly resolve the issue and reclaim funds, promoting an efficient process in legal and financial matters. Additionally, this letter serves as a formal record, which can assist in compliance and auditing requirements. Overall, it is a straightforward tool for managing financial discrepancies in a professional tone.
